What are Textron Aviation Pilots?

Textron Aviation Pilots are professional aviators who operate aircraft manufactured by Textron Aviation, such as Cessna and Beechcraft planes. These pilots may work for private owners, charter services, corporations, or government agencies, flying a range of missions from business travel to medical transport. In addition to safely operating the aircraft, they are responsible for pre-flight planning, navigation, and ensuring compliance with all aviation regulations. Textron Aviation Pilots are typically required to hold relevant pilot licenses and have specific training on the aircraft models they fly.

How does a Textron Aviation Pilot typically collaborate with ground crew and maintenance teams during flight operations?

Textron Aviation Pilots work closely with ground crew and maintenance teams to ensure aircraft safety and operational readiness. Before each flight, pilots conduct thorough pre-flight briefings with maintenance personnel to review the aircraft's status, address any reported discrepancies, and verify that all maintenance checks have been completed. During operations, pilots maintain clear communication with ground crew to coordinate fueling, loading, and other logistical needs. This teamwork is essential for timely departures and helps identify and resolve potential issues quickly, ensuring safe and efficient flight operations.

Description JOB SUMMARY

The production flight test and delivery pilot is responsible for conducting production flight testing and customer delivery flights to ensure a thoroughly tested, quality aircraft is delivered and ensuring all production aircraft comply with the applicable FAA, Textron Aviation specs and customer quality standards. Customer support flights involving off-site trips as well as flight testing after major repair and modification.

JOB RESPONSIBILITIES
  • Production flight testing of new Single Engine Piston and Caravan aircraft.
  • Aircraft delivery of Single Engine Piston and Caravan aircraft.
  • Customer support activities to include flight testing aircraft after major modifications or repairs.
  • Travel to off-site facilities for aircraft delivery and customer support.
  • Adaptability to a dynamic flight schedule.
  • Perform production test flights, required ground inspections and aircraft delivery flights of new and pre‑owned Textron Aviation aircraft in accordance with applicable FAA and Textron Aviation FT's.
  • Maintain a thorough knowledge of appropriate aircraft models, systems, avionics, equipment, options, product changes and updates.
  • Record aircraft discrepancies in a thorough and precise manner and maintain aircraft documentation in an accurate and timely fashion.
  • Provide management with ideas and input regarding continuous improvements to products and processes.
  • Adhere to and support Flight Operations policies, procedures, guidelines and responsibilities.
  • Communicate with and ensure department personnel are aware of noteworthy issues.
  • Maintain safety as the prime consideration for all operations at all times.
Qualifications EDUCATION/ EXPERIENCE
  • Bachelor’s Degree required in:
    • Business Management
    • Aerospace
    • Other related fields
  • Commercial Pilot Certificate required
  • ATP (Airline Transport Pilot Certificate) recommended
  • Level will be based on relevant experience, scope of role, and manager’s discretion.
QUALIFICATIONS
  • Ability to obtain a valid US Passport required
  • Ability to support off‑site travel for customer support and deliveries
  • 1200 hours total time required
  • FAA First Class Medical required
  • Must have valid driver's license
